Output 58b5e400a202ebb08fc47dd00ba56796e69ae57ec2eefcaa980cf3d920b205f1:0

value
1270361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f8ab30d55c57a017e4cd7b8585909fc1d3d573 OP_EQUAL
address
3DipLUiXtDJt7Et5duvti59tmJYYqUbYpK
transaction
58b5e400a202ebb08fc47dd00ba56796e69ae57ec2eefcaa980cf3d920b205f1
confirmations
206638
spent
true